Selly Oak station is equipped with a ticket office open from early morning until late evening across the week, ensuring you can grab your tickets at a convenient time. For tech-savvy travelers, ticket machines are available and accessible, allowing the collection of tickets purchased online. Notably, there's a step-free access category 'A'—meaning unimpeded access to all platforms. This station supports individuals with disabilities or mobility impairments with induction loops and accessible toilets, although no wheelchairs are available onsite.
The station also boasts secure surveillance through CCTV, adding an extra layer of protection for all passengers. While there's no waiting room, ample seating is available. You'll find no refreshment facilities within the station, but the surrounding area is dotted with cafes and eateries for a quick bite or a leisurely coffee.
Selly Oak station provides easy access to multiple transport links, making your journey seamless. Rail replacement services pick up from the front of the station, ensuring continuity even during service hiccups. For private travel needs, several taxi services such as Elite and Castle offer convenient pickups. Although no car hire facilities are directly associated with the station, the proximity to Birmingham ensures quick access to varied transport services.

Westerfield Station might not be the largest, but it offers essential facilities to keep your journey on track. While there isn't a ticket office, rest assured—ticket machines are available for both pur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ets. Accessibility is a priority here with the availability of step-free access to both platforms, accessible ticket machines, and induction loops for those with hearing aids.
Informational services are a strong suit, with departure screens and announcements keeping passengers in the know. Help is available via customer help points, and there's CCTV for added security. Though lacking in wa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, a seating area offers a respite as you wait for your train.
For those keen on exploring the surrounding area, it’s important to note that rail replacement bus services don't serve Westerfield. If in need, Ipswich station is your go-to for this service. While the station is minimal in taxi and car hire options, bicycle enthusiasts will find limited but available cycle storage facilities—ideal for those continuing their journey on two wheels.
